## Formula sandbox tuning

User-supplied formulas in Gridmoor execute inside a restricted interpreter with hard ceilings on time, memory, and call depth. Reviewers should confirm any change to these ceilings is justified in the PR description, since raising them widens the abuse surface. Defaults were chosen from production traces. The current limits are as follows.

limits module of tafog-fawip:
WEIGHTS = {
    "julix": 57,
    "lamys": 992,
    "kasvan": 209,
    "quenok": 750,
    "alddor": 259,
    "oliath": 1009,
    "wenix": 815,
}

# Build Provenance: Ledgerpane Audit-Log Viewer

On-call: every Ledgerpane deploy is signed and traceable. To verify what's running, open the viewer footer and compare the token against the provenance registry entry for that release. Mismatch means an unsigned build — page the release owner immediately and freeze deploys. Do not restart the service first; that wipes the in-memory attestation. The current verified token is recorded below.

pipeline stamp: htk9_ce63042d9

**Ticket GRV-412 — Sign-off needed: dependency graph visualizer memory fix**

The Lattice Explorer visualizer was holding the full resolved graph of every workspace in memory, causing the Fenwick build agents to swap under load. This patch streams nodes in batches and evicts collapsed subtrees. Please verify the rendered graph still matches the lockfile for at least two large repos before approving. Sign-off must come from the responsible engineer named below.

named custodian: Quenael Briax